One Eight Hundred delivers at Pocono in Weiss Series

At 0h02, on April 4, 2021 By POCONO DOWNS

One Eight Hundred, a 3-year-old colt who is the progeny of world champions Somebeachsomewhere-Economy Terror soared to take his first start in 2021 in 1:50.2 in one of five $17,500 prelimary rounds of the Bobby Weiss Series at The Downs at Mohegan Sun at Pocono Downs on Saturday (April 3). The other victors were Coalition Hanover, Tarkio, Mad Man Hill and Straight Talk.

Got his name because he cost $800,000 as a yearling, One Eight Hundred left right out to the lead and posted fractions of :28.2, :56.2, and 1:24.1. Then, he downshifted on the far turn and he buzzed the huge final quarter to make himself the fastest three-year-old in North America in 2021.

The Weiss Series for trotters was for the same purse amount as the pacers and the winners were Top Me Off, Tricky Dick, and Hoolie N Hector.
